Chapter 8
Liora felt her curiosity rise. What was Kin doing here?
He swiped his boots on the mat but didn’t enter. He tilted his head toward the yard. “Got some other men who might be able to shed some light on the situation.”
Reagan and Joe exchanged a look, and then were the first to follow Kin as he stepped off the porch.
Everyone else crowded to follow.
Kin stepped over to a man draped over a horse. “I need some help to get him down. And it would probably be good if Aidan rode for Doc.”
Susan Kastain hoisted her skirts and turned for the house. “I’ll fix a bed. Aidan—”
“I know. I know.” The boy groused before she could get another word out. “I’ll fetch the doc.” He stepped off the porch and dragged himself toward the barn. “I always miss out on all the fun!”
Liora and Aurora stepped to one side of the porch as Reagan, Joe and the parson moved to help Kin, and the Carver siblings gathered on the other side of the porch.
A second man sat with his hands lashed to the saddle of a nearby horse, but Liora noted that Kin had tied his mount off to the hitching rail.
“Who are these men?” Joe asked as they helped the wounded and moaning man down. Reagan and Kin had the man drape his arms around their necks and then they lifted him, each carrying one leg.
“This one is named Shade,” Kin puffed as they shuffled toward the porch.
Reagan gave the man a second look. “Any relation to Bobby Shade?”
After they’d seated him on the porch steps with his busted leg stretched out before him, Shade folded his arms. “Bobby is my cousin. My given name is Dorian. But just because he’s an outlaw that doesn’t make me one.”
Kin rolled his eyes and launched into his tale of how he’d waited, and how the men had tried to ambush him.
“We weren’t going to shoot at you until you made a run for it,” Shade groused, rubbing a hand over his face.
Kin pointed at the man on the horse. “That man is Ab Saunders. He claims he’s Ruby’s husband. He took something from her and it’s in his coat pocket.”
Reagan gave Joe a nod, then shucked his pistol and held it on the man as Joe strode over and cut Ab’s bonds.
Moving slowly, the man dismounted.
Joe motioned for him to lift his hands. “No funny business. I’m going to check your pockets.”
Ab sighed. “It’s a locket. I gave it to her on our wedding day.”
Joe extracted and held up a chain with an oval locket on it, just as the man had said.
Joe opened it, then lifted his gaze to Reagan’s. “Picture of him on one side, and her on the other.”
Ab turned his palms to the sky. “I wanted it as a memento, is all.”
